Here’s how Fractional CTOs and Tech Board Advisors collaborate effectively:

 

  1. Defining the vision together:

Think of this like setting the GPS for a road trip. The Tech Board Advisor helps establish the destination—long-term tech goals and strategy—while the Fractional CTO maps the route to get there.

 

  1. Translating strategy into action:
Advisors focus on the big picture, but Fractional CTOs break it down into actionable steps. For example, if the strategy involves adopting AI, the Fractional CTO identifies the tools, vendors, and timeline to make it happen.

 

  1. Sharing expertise across levels: 
The Tech Board Advisor provides high-level guidance to the board and stakeholders, while the Fractional CTO works directly with teams to implement the plan. This ensures alignment from top to bottom.
 
  1. Tackling challenges collaboratively:
When roadblocks arise, the Fractional CTO handles the immediate technical issues while the Tech Board Advisor evaluates whether adjustments to the overall strategy are needed.
 
  1. Ensuring continuity:
Advisors often have periodic involvement, while Fractional CTOs provide consistent, hands-on leadership. Together, they ensure the strategy stays on track, even between advisory sessions.
